Roundtable: Teaching Criminal Justice –Where Do We Go From Here?

Wed, Nov 15, 11:00am to 12:20pm, Marriott, Conference Suite II, 3rd Floor

Session Submission Type: Roundtable Session

Abstract

The Criminal Justice field has experienced a turbulent and controversial year with instances of conflict, violence and protests. The impact of “mainstream media” and social media has failed to objectively disseminate information to the public. This has left students with skewed impressions of how the system operates and created negative interpretations without constructive change. This has led to issues in the classroom with professors placed in difficult and conflicted situations. This roundtable will examine issues, critiquing and re-examining damaging perceptions as well as possible remedies. Finally, the discussion will focus on how course objectives can be achieved in a safe atmosphere where discussion and intellectual discourse can be created without fear of repercussions.
